Just back from a weekend break and had a listen to the Youtube clip. The first thing to say is that Marvin R. may be singing live, but the backing is surely a track (no lead on the guitar, no mics on the drums etc). There's also a piano and and an acoustic rhythm guitar in the mix (from the house band presumably). Like so many 'live' TV performances, what you see on the screen is for the convenience of the production rather than as a true guide to 'who played what'.
